#578c4c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#578c4c is composed of 34.1% red, 54.9%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 45.7%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 109.7 degrees, a saturation of 29.6% and a lightness of 42.4%. #578c4c color hex could be obtained by blending #aeff98 with #001900.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

● #578c4c color description : Dark moderate lime green.
#578c4c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#578c4c has RGB values of R:87, G:140, B:76 and CMYK values of C:0.38, M:0, Y:0.46,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 5737548.
